Xi Set To Consolidate Power By Curbing Communist Youth League by Nullen: 2:11pm On Sep 30, 2016
BEIJING (Reuters) – A year before a Communist Party conclave that could decide who will eventually replace him as China’s next leader, President Xi Jinping is maneuvering to reduce the power of a rival political bloc while seeking to get members of his own faction onto the country’s top ruling body, according to three sources with ties to the leadership.
